Different Types of Cooling Systems

Wine fridges generally buddy up to one of three cooling styles: compressor, thermoelectric, and dual-zone. Think of them as different suits for different needs; they each shine in their own special way.

Cooling System Description Best For
Compressor Cooling Runs on a compressor and refrigerant, like your standard fridge. Keeps things chill in pretty much any situation. Big collections; rooms where temps love to dance.
Thermoelectric Cooling Does a fan-and-heat-exchange two-step. Quiet as a whisper and easy on the juice. Smaller collections; peace and quiet seekers.
Dual-Zone Cooling A double agent with two temperature zones for reds and whites. Variety-seeking wine aficionados.

Maintenance and Care

Keeping your wine fridge in tip-top shape isn't just for show—it's all about keeping your vino perfectly chilled and tasty. Here’s how you can keep your wine fridge purring smoothly and your bottles ready to impress.

Tips for Proper Maintenance

  1. Regular Temperature Checks: Peek at your fridge’s temp now and then to make sure your wine isn’t getting roasted or frosty. Keeping it between 45°F and 65°F is where the magic happens.

  2. Keep It Level: Set your fridge on flat ground, or it might end up sounding like a grumbling stomach—not to mention messing with your cooling.

  3. Avoid Overloading: Jam-packing your fridge might seem efficient, but it can suffocate airflow. Give those bottles some breathing space to keep things chill.

  4. Filter and Vent: Dust off those air filters every few months. If it’s got vents, keep ‘em unblocked to help your wine fridge breathe easy.

  5. Prevent Humidity Issues: Mind the moisture—shoot for between 50% and 70% humidity. If it's on the dry side, a little dish of water can do wonders.

Cleaning and Troubleshooting Guidelines

A clean wine fridge is a happy wine fridge! Here’s your checklist to keep it shining:

  1. Unplug the Unit: Safety first! Unplug your fridge before you get in there for a scrub down.

  2. Wipe Down the Interior: Grab a soft cloth, some warm water, and mild soap, then give the inside a gentle wipe. Leave the heavy-duty stuff for your pots and pans.

  3. Clean the Shelves: Pull out those shelves and give them a warm, soapy bath. Rinse and dry well before sliding them back in.

  4. Regular Exterior Maintenance: Dust off the outside to keep it looking sharp. For stainless steel, a special cleaner might just make it shine brighter than a new penny.

  5. Check the Drainage: If you’ve got a drainage setup, make sure it's not starting its own funky waterworks. A quick check can keep leaks at bay.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

Issue Why It Happens Fix-it Trick
Fridge isn't cooling well Oops, wrong temp setting Double-check and tweak the settings.
Lots of noise It’s wobbling around Even it out—nobody likes a wobbly fridge.
Condensation inside It's steamy or overstuffed Lighten the load and maybe consider a dehumidifier.
Funky smell Sneaky spills or food stowaways Clean the inside and peek at the drainage system.
